Protein metabolism in chronic kidney disease

Effects of a low protein diet and of a keto/amino acid supplemented very low protein diet on muscle protein metabolism and myostatin in patients with chronic kidney disease

Inclusion criteria

Inclusion criteria: 1. Aged 18-79, both males and females 2. Non-diabetic CKD (Stages 4-5, estimated glomerular filtration rate [eGFR] 12-25 ml/min) 3. Compliance to treatment

Exclusion criteria

Exclusion criteria: 1. Evidence of congestive heart failure 2. Incapable of following study requirements to control diet 3. A recent myocardial infarction 4. Pregnancy 5. Unstable renal function 6. Recent (<3 months) infection history 7. Clinical evidence of gastrointestinal or liver diseases 8. Alcoholism 9. Drug abuse 10. Final diagnosis of malignancy

Design outcomes

Primary

MeasureTime frame
Protein metabolism measured at baseline and at the end of each six-week experimental period

Secondary

MeasureTime frame
Serum/muscle myostatin measured at baseline and at the end of each six-week experimental period
